Output cdf95d48280091a8e0a81055417d075352e16cd0b3b646895f532177b9441c09:22

value
5057200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ab08fc17f8647914ea19f7f23aa68d4af9e23e76 OP_EQUAL
address
3HHNEcmUu34Fiz7R9b3cVw1aHbwhoPTgnB
transaction
cdf95d48280091a8e0a81055417d075352e16cd0b3b646895f532177b9441c09
confirmations
326591
spent
true